Treatment Contrast
When contrasting PRK and LASIK, it is very important to recognize the differences in their respective treatments.
PRK, or photorefractive keratectomy, includes the removal of the outer layer of the cornea prior to improving it with a laser to deal with vision issues. This treatment appropriates for individuals with thin corneas or those who may have various other corneal problems.
On the other hand, LASIK, or laser-assisted in situ keratomileusis, entails producing a thin flap on the cornea, which is then raised to allow the laser to reshape the underlying cells. This procedure is typically liked for people with thick corneas and provides a much faster recovery time contrasted to PRK.

Healing Time Differences
After comprehending the differences in the treatments in between PRK and LASIK, it is very important to consider the healing time distinctions. Below are 5 bottom lines to bear in mind:
- PRK generally has a much longer recovery period compared to LASIK. With PRK, it can take up to a week or longer for your vision to stabilize, while LASIK people commonly experience renovation within a day or two.

- PRK patients may experience pain and sensitivity in the initial couple of days after surgery, while LASIK people generally have minimal pain.
- Both PRK and LASIK may need using prescription eye drops throughout the recovery duration to avoid infection and advertise healing.

Possible Risks and Considerations
Prior to choosing, it's important to understand the prospective risks and considerations related to PRK and LASIK laser eye surgeries. While both procedures are generally safe and efficient, there are still a few things you need to remember.
One major threat is the opportunity of experiencing dry eyes after surgical treatment. This is extra common with LASIK, however can also accompany PRK. Momentary aesthetic disruptions, such as glare, halos, and dual vision, are additionally feasible side effects.
